pub struct RepeatedRules {
pub min_items: Option<u64>,
pub max_items: Option<u64>,
pub unique: Option<bool>,
pub items: Option<Box<FieldRules>>,
pub ignore_empty: Option<bool>,
}
Expand description
RepeatedRules describe the constraints applied to repeated
values
Fields§
§min_items: Option<u64>
MinItems specifies that this field must have the specified number of items at a minimum
max_items: Option<u64>
MaxItems specifies that this field must have the specified number of items at a maximum
unique: Option<bool>
Unique specifies that all elements in this field must be unique. This constraint is only applicable to scalar and enum types (messages are not supported).
items: Option<Box<FieldRules>>
Items specifies the constraints to be applied to each item in the field. Repeated message fields will still execute validation against each item unless skip is specified here.
ignore_empty: Option<bool>
IgnoreEmpty specifies that the validation rules of this field should be evaluated only if the field is not empty
